Ingredients List

  • 2 pounds Brussels sprouts, trimmed and halved
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• 1 cup sour cream
  • 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1/4 cup breadcrumbs
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• Salt and pepper to taste

How to Prepare Cheesy Brussel Sprout Bake

Preheat the Oven

First things first, you’ll want to pre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). This step is super important because it ensures your cheesy Brussels sprout bake cooks evenly. Nobody likes a dish that’s half-cooked, right? So, let that oven warm up while you get everything else ready!

Cook the Brussels Sprouts

Now, grab those trimmed and halved Brussels sprouts and b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Once it’s bubbling away, toss in the Brussels sprouts and let them cook for about 5 minutes. This quick blanching helps soften them just enough without losing that delightful crunch. After they’re done, drain them well and transfer them to a mixing bowl. Easy peasy!

Mix the Ingredients

Here comes the fun part! Add in your shredded cheddar cheese, sour cream, grated Parmesan cheese, minced garlic, and a sprinkle of salt and pepper to the bowl with your Brussels sprouts. Now, get in there with a spatula or a big spoon and mix everything together until it’s all well combined. You want those sprouts to be coated in cheesy goodness—trust me, this mixture is where the magic happens!

Transfer to Baking Dish

Once everything is mixed up nicely, it’s time to transfer that cheesy mixture into a baking dish. Spread it out evenly so it bakes uniformly. You don’t want some parts to be all gooey while others are undercooked, right? Just give it a little pat down if needed, and make sure it looks nice and even!

Bake the Dish

Finally, pop that baking dish into your preheated oven and bake for about 25-30 minutes. You’ll know it’s done when the top is golden and bubbly—oh, the smell will be heavenly! Let it cool for a few minutes before serving, and then get ready to dig in. You’ll be amazed at how delicious Brussels sprouts can be when they’re dressed up like this!

Tips for Success

Alright, let’s make sure your cheesy Brussels sprout bake turns out absolutely perfect! Here are some of my favorite tips that I swear by:

  • Use Fresh Ingredients: Fresh Brussels sprouts make a world of difference! Look for bright green ones that feel firm to the touch. Avoid any that are wilted or have yellow leaves.
  • Don’t Overcook the Sprouts: Remember, the goal is to blanch them just enough. You want them tender but still slightly crisp, as they’ll continue cooking in the oven.
  • Mix It Up: Feel free to get creative! Adding some cooked bacon or pancetta can give your dish a smoky flavor that’s just divine. Or toss in some sautéed onions for a sweet touch!
  • Cheese Lovers Unite: If you’re a cheese fanatic like me, try mixing different cheeses! Gruyère or mozzarella can add a lovely melty texture, while a sprinkle of blue cheese on top just before serving adds an exciting punch.
  • Make It Ahead: Want to save some time? You can prepare the dish a day in advance. Just mix everything together, transfer it to the baking dish, cover it tightly, and pop it in the fridge. Bake it right before serving!
  • Keep an Eye on It: Ovens can vary, so keep an eye on your bake as it cooks. If it starts to brown too quickly, cover it loosely with foil to prevent burning.

Storage & Reheating Instructions

So, you’ve made this delicious cheesy Brussels sprout bake and now you’ve got some leftovers—lucky you! Here’s how to store them properly so they stay just as tasty for your next meal.

First, let the bake cool completely before storing it. This helps prevent condensation, which can make your dish soggy. Transfer any leftovers into an airtight container, and you can keep it in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. Just make sure to label it with the date so you remember when you made it!

If you want to keep it for longer, you can also freeze it! Just wrap individual portions tightly in plastic wrap, then place them in a freezer-safe bag or container. It’ll stay fresh for about 2-3 months. When you’re ready to enjoy it again, simply thaw it overnight in the fridge.

Now, for reheating—this is where it gets exciting! If you’re reheating from the fridge, pre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and place the dish in a baking pan covered with foil. Heat it for about 15-20 minutes, or until it’s heated through. This method keeps the cheesy goodness intact and avoids that weird microwave texture.

And if you’re reheating from frozen, you can either thaw it overnight and follow the same oven method, or pop it straight into a preheated oven for about 30-40 minutes. Just make sure it’s heated all the way through, and you’re good to go! Enjoy those cheesy leftovers—you deserve it!

FAQ Section

Can I use frozen Brussels sprouts?
Oh, definitely! While fresh is always best for that vibrant crunch, frozen Brussels sprouts can work in a pinch. Just make sure to thaw and drain them well before mixing them into your cheesy goodness to avoid extra moisture.

What can I substitute for sour cream?
If you’re not a fan of sour cream or need a dairy-free option, Greek yogurt is a fantastic substitute! It brings that creamy texture and tangy flavor without missing a beat. You can also try a dairy-free sour cream alternative!

How do I know when the bake is done?
Great question! You’ll want to look for that golden, bubbly top—if it looks like a bubbly cheese dream, it’s ready to come out! Also, if you gently press on the center, it should feel firm but not hard. Oh, the smell will be a good indicator too—trust your nose!

Can I add more veggies to this dish?
Absolutely! Feel free to sneak in some cooked spinach, kale, or even roasted carrots to amp up the nutrition. Just make sure to chop them finely so they mix well with the Brussels sprouts!

What should I serve with my cheesy Brussels sprout bake?
This dish pairs beautifully with just about anything, but I especially love serving it as a side with roasted chicken or grilled steak. It also makes a hearty, vegetarian main when paired with a fresh salad or some crusty bread!

How do I store leftovers?
Let the bake cool completely, then store any le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3-4 days. You can also freeze it, just wrap portions tightly and enjoy them later!

Can I make this dish ahead of time?
You bet! Just prepare everything up to the baking step, cover it tightly, and pop it in the fridge. When you’re ready to serve, bake it straight from the fridge—just add a few extra minutes to the baking time!

cheesy brussel sprout bake

Cheesy Brussels Sprout Bake: 5 Reasons You’ll Love It


  • Author: Julia marin
  • Total Time: 45 minutes
  • Yield: 6 servings 1x
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Description

A creamy and cheesy baked dish featuring Brussels sprouts.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 pounds Brussels sprouts, trimmed and halved
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• 1 cup sour cream
  • 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1/4 cup breadcrumbs
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. In a large pot of boiling salted water, cook Brussels sprouts for 5 minutes.
  3. Drain and transfer to a mixing bowl.
  4. Add cheddar cheese, sour cream, Parmesan cheese, garlic, salt, and pepper to the bowl.
  5. Mix until well combined.
  6. Transfer the mixture to a baking dish and spread evenly.
  7. Sprinkle breadcrumbs on top.
  8. Bake for 25-30 minutes until golden and bubbly.
